Transaction 2066f6f677fc36ce0ccede5c3c9310a43d9ecb4f452e403ce2038bc2a180e45f

1 Input
2 Outputs
  • 2066f6f677fc36ce0ccede5c3c9310a43d9ecb4f452e403ce2038bc2a180e45f:0
  • value  37441193564
    address  17WdywGM2rbLkqzNkPjpfvwzyFHmzsDbXQ
  • 2066f6f677fc36ce0ccede5c3c9310a43d9ecb4f452e403ce2038bc2a180e45f:1
  • value  11756410
    address  3EZNd52FzNt8oiNFiBRp5kDbsRVRUU79Th